There where three. The full din keyboard plug, serial for your mouse and that unholy thing on the back of your sound blaster on which you could connect a joystick.
Somewhere in my giant box of cables I have an adapter for attaching MIDI cables to the joystick port. When I actually used a MIDI keyboard with it, I had… variable success.
The first time I had a MIDI keyboard that just worked, it used USB as transport. (And it has worked great since. I think it’s the only USB Mini plug device device I still regularly use.)
Crazy thing is, MIDI is absolutely ancient. You’d imagine it’d work fine on the gameports, but nope. Legacy PC ports are cursed. Except audio jacks and serial ports, and VGA if you’re really into screwing things in place.
There where three. The full din keyboard plug, serial for your mouse and that unholy thing on the back of your sound blaster on which you could connect a joystick.
Somewhere in my giant box of cables I have an adapter for attaching MIDI cables to the joystick port. When I actually used a MIDI keyboard with it, I had… variable success.
The first time I had a MIDI keyboard that just worked, it used USB as transport. (And it has worked great since. I think it’s the only USB Mini plug device device I still regularly use.)
Crazy thing is, MIDI is absolutely ancient. You’d imagine it’d work fine on the gameports, but nope. Legacy PC ports are cursed. Except audio jacks and serial ports, and VGA if you’re really into screwing things in place.
That’s a midi port
It’s supposed to be, but it’s really just a joystick port.
That’s how most people used it, yeah. But it’s meant to be a midi port which is why it’s on sound cards.
It often worked poorly as such though. While it worked great as a joystick port. I drew my own conclusions.
Tbf most things worked poorly back then. I constantly had to pop my 386 open and jiggle the ram to get it to boot
That’s… not typical though.
It was. Hardware was absolute trash in the early-mid 90s.